利用GitHub创建个人学术网站的全面指南

在当今数字化时代,学术研究人员和学生都在寻求新的方式来展示自己的工作。GitHub作为一个开源项目托管平台,提供了一个强大的工具来帮助用户创建和维护个人学术网站。本文将深入探讨如何使用GitHub创建个人学术网站,并讨论相关的最佳实践和技巧。

为什么选择GitHub作为个人学术网站的托管平台?

1. 免费且开放源代码

GitHub为用户提供免费的托管服务,适合预算有限的研究人员和学生。同时,开源的特性允许用户随意修改和分发代码。

2. 版本控制

使用GitHub的版本控制系统,可以轻松追踪网站的更改,便于在必要时进行恢复或回溯。

3. 社区支持

GitHub拥有活跃的社区,用户可以轻松获取支持和建议,还能通过社区交流和合作,提升研究成果的影响力。

如何开始创建个人学术网站?

1. 注册GitHub账号

  • 前往GitHub官网进行注册。
  • 提供必要的信息并验证邮箱。

2. 创建新的GitHub Repository

  • 登录后,点击右上角的加号,选择“New repository”。
  • 为仓库命名,例如“myacademicwebsite”。
  • 选择“Public”或“Private”权限。
  • 勾选“Initialize this repository with a README”。

3. 使用GitHub Pages

GitHub Pages是一个方便的工具,可以将静态网站托管在GitHub上。

  • 在仓库页面中,进入“Settings”选项卡。
  • 向下滚动到“GitHub Pages”部分,选择主分支作为源。点击“Save”。

4. 选择模板或框架

可以选择使用现成的模板或框架,推荐如下:

  • Jekyll:一个静态站点生成器,适合个人博客和学术网站。
  • Hugo:一个快速且灵活的静态站点生成器。

5. 定制个人网站

  • 根据个人需求,修改网站内容和布局。
  • 更新README.md文件,添加个人简介、研究领域、项目链接等。

添加学术作品和成果

1. 撰写和发布论文

  • 创建一个新的文件夹用于存放论文,如“publications”。
  • 将论文以PDF格式上传,或者直接将文本内容添加到页面中。

2. 项目展示

  • 在仓库中创建一个“projects”文件夹,展示自己的研究项目和相关成果。
  • 使用Markdown文件详细描述每个项目。

3. 个人博客

  • 可使用Jekyll或其他博客生成器创建个人博客,分享研究进展和学术见解。

优化网站的可见性

1. SEO优化

  • 使用适当的关键词和描述,提高网站在搜索引擎中的排名。
  • 定期更新内容,保持网站的活跃性。

2. 社交媒体推广

  • 在学术社交平台上分享网站链接,如ResearchGate、LinkedIn等。
  • 利用Twitter、Facebook等社交媒体提升可见性。

3. 网络链接

  • 主动与同行交流,获取反向链接,提高网站的可信度和流量。

FAQ:常见问题解答

Q1: GitHub个人学术网站是否收费?

GitHub Pages提供免费的托管服务,因此建立个人学术网站不需要额外费用。用户只需一个免费的GitHub账号。

Q2: 我需要编程基础才能创建GitHub个人学术网站吗?

虽然了解基本的HTML、CSS和Markdown将帮助您更好地定制网站,但GitHub提供的模板和界面也非常友好,初学者可以轻松上手。

Q3: 如何保持个人学术网站的更新?

定期撰写新的文章,上传最新的研究成果,并关注领域内的趋势和动态。定期检查链接的有效性和内容的相关性。

Q4: GitHub个人学术网站的访问权限如何设置?

您可以在创建仓库时选择公共或私有。对于个人学术网站,通常建议选择公共,以提高可见性。

Q5: 如何在个人学术网站中添加交互元素?

您可以利用JavaScript和CSS添加交互效果。很多开源模板都已经集成了这些功能,只需根据需要进行配置即可。

结论

通过使用GitHub创建个人学术网站,不仅可以展示自己的研究成果,还能提升个人品牌和学术影响力。无论您是学生还是资深研究人员,GitHub都是一个极具价值的工具,帮助您在学术界建立自己的声誉。通过不断优化和更新,您的个人学术网站将成为一个展示学术成就的重要平台。

正文完